Depends on your gaming preferences. :)

For an MMORPG consider.
Star Wars The Old Republic (SWTOR) It's F2P, and has 8 story arc's.
Star Trek Online (STO) It's also F2P, and has 3+ story's.

For Online First Person Shooters.
Team Fortress 2. Also F2P.
Counter Strike, Source or Global Offensive.
Left 4 Dead 2.

Single Player story games.
Tomb Raider 2013.
BioShock (1, 2, Infinity, Buried at Sea.)
Half Life (1, 2 + Episodes.)
COD MW (1, 2, 3) All had good campaigns.

Racing games.
Assetto Corsa.
Project Cars.


One of the area's that PC differs from consoles, has been the development of Independent games:
Funded internally at great risk, and then later by Early access to games.
Most of these are unfinished and buggy, but have opened up niece markets.
Some of my favorite are:
Kerbal Space Program.
Castle Story.
Space Engineers.
Beamng Drive.
Dayz.

And there is many more indie games to consider, an support. :)
Either way, as PC gamers. We generally get a wider selection of games, compared to consoles (Not considering the exclusives), and generally our games have better graphics + modding support. :cool:
